Mr. Carr serves today (2005) as the Chief executive officer and Lead Technologist of agilefactor, a New York Corporation. He is also the co-author of the soon to be released book on Agile software development innovations he and his co-author (Brian Button) have invented. Damon Carr is a Patent Holder on 'A Software Platform for Wealth Management' and has a Patent-Pending for the 'Core Agility Ratio', a metric for the Management of Agile Software Team Projects and Object-oriented software quality.

Previously Mr. Carr was the Chief technical officer and co-founder of Monetaire, where he architected and executed a software product that was named one of only three 'leaders' (the highest classification) by Forrester Research for the Financial Services Industry in Europe. In 2003 Mr. Carr was a featured presenter at the Microsoft Financial Services Developers Conference.

Mr. Carr is a professional member of the Association for Computing Machinery (ACM). He has lectured at Columbia University on Microsoft .NET at the Master's Level in Computer Science. His firm agilefactor is a Microsoft Certified Partner and Member of the Visual Studio Integration Partner Program.

In addition, Mr. Carr is the lead developer and Architect of the DotNet2UML utility, a widely used software tool for converting Microsoft .NET Assemblies into XMI (the Object Management Group's XML based interchange format for the Unified Modeling Language. Mr. Carr received his Bachelors of Science degree in Business and Management Information Systems in 1993 from California State University, Sacramento, the very college his Grandfather (Dr. Norman J. Hunt) taught at for over twenty years. He later went on to conduct Master's Level study at Columbia University in Manhattan.

Mr. Carr started programming when he was 12 in 1982 on the Atari 800, which he mastered and actually sold some of his software creations (mostly games), his first entrepreneurial venture.

From the years 1976-1984 Mr. Carr became a virtuoso on the Trombone through the efforts of his mentor, and legal guardian, Dr. Norman J. Hunt. Dr. Norman J. Hunt was a globally know composer, conductor, arranger, and performer in the big band era. Dr. Hunt later was the head of the California State University, Sacramento's Music Department.
